Hmm, I don't know about Sondheim saying that. Lapine, as Alan notes in his notes,said something to that effect and Sondheim claims he never even read Bettelheim.
It is fairly obvious that Lapine had read him and by the time ITW was written, Bettelheim was in major disregard on many fronts.
Other than that, who knows? "No One is Alone" does appear, to me at least, to be strongly influenced by Jung. In a rather obvious way actually.
